One World Journeys | Chimpanzees: Messengers from the Forest
Yet, today, there is an urgent need to protect chimpanzees from disappearing from the wild. Due to pressures ranging from civil unrest and deforestation to the bushmeat trade and exploitation for entertainment, the survival of wild chimpanzees is in doubt.
